Description Michael OBrien CLA 2009-11-10 09:46:09 EST
>suggestion from senior member of team - that I agree with - that should be done in the future.
Currently the web application tutorials for WebLogic and OC4J (and pending for GlassFish) are geared to SVN download and building/deploying from eclipse.

It would be better for users that want to quickly deploy the EAR without installing Eclipse and SVN to be able to get the EAR (including source).

This will need to be passed by council because normally all binary transfers must go through the SVN or download servers and be updated as part of the build process.  If we bypass this by manually regenerating the EAR when the source is modified and posting it as an attachement to a bug or the wiki page...

http://wiki.eclipse.org/EclipseLink/Examples/JPA/WebLogic_Web_Tutorial

...We will be contravening standard procedures - however we are talking about a 60k EAR file that is modified only quarterly.
